A BAE Systems’ investigation discovered a common link between the $81 million Bangladesh Bank cyber theft and the 2014 hack on Sony Pictures, ZDNet reports. The security firm discovered malware used to attack the Bangladesh Bank and another Vietnamese commercial bank was also used to compromise Sony Pictures, leading BAE to believe the same person or group is responsible for all three attacks. "What initially looked to be an isolated incident at one Asian bank turned out to be part of a wider campaign. This led to the identification of a commercial bank in Vietnam that also appears to have been targeted in a similar fashion using tailored malware, but based off a common code-base," said BAE Systems security researchers Sergei Shevchenko and Adrian Nish in a blog post.
